Supporting Open Source with Joseph Finney
.NET Rocks!3 Touko 2023

Supporting Open Source with Joseph Finney

How do we support open-source projects? Carl and Richard talk to Joseph Finney about his ongoing efforts to build various projects in his spare time while still working a regular day job. Joe talks about the options to contribute to open-source, including submitting issues to help improve the project, code contributions where you add to the body of work, and financial options - contributing money directly to the creator. The conversation explores some of the existing tooling and more opportunities that could be created to make it easier for organizations to see their dependence on open-source libraries in a path that would make it easier to garner support for creators. The open-source world continues to evolve, and with some effort, we can make it more sustainable and valuable for everyone.

Jaksot(1959)

Eric Lippert Talks About Project Roslyn

Eric Lippert Talks About Project Roslyn

Recorded on PI day, Carl and Richard talk to the one-and-only Eric Lippert from the C# Compiler team. But we don't only talk about C#! The conversation wanders around all the languages, a little F#, a little IronPython, heck, even VB.NET! Eric talks about Project Roslyn, Microsoft's efforts to make the C# compiler available as a service. A little artificial intelligence, a little parallelism, and you've got one brain twisting show!Support this podcast at — https://redcircle.com/net-rocks/donations

29 Maalis 201157min

Jean Paoli is All About Web Interoperability

Jean Paoli is All About Web Interoperability

Carl and Richard talk to Jean Paoli, the General Manager of Interoperability Strategy at Microsoft. Jean Paoli was part of the team at the W3C that created the XML specification. Jean does a great job of helping us understand how huge the interoperability effort at Microsoft is. He also digs into the iterative (almost agile!) process of developing web specifications by building prototype code and taking that experience back to the working group.Support this podcast at — https://redcircle.com/net-rocks/donations

24 Maalis 201158min

Adam Driscoll Does PowerShell with TFS

Adam Driscoll Does PowerShell with TFS

Carl and Richard talk to Adam Driscoll of Quest Software. The conversation starts with a discussion around Adam's TFS plugin for Android. Then it moves into PowerGUI and the PowerGUI extensions for Visual Studio. PowerGUI is a UI for writing PowerShell scripts and PowerGUI VSX ties PowerGUI into Studio. Adam talks about applications can be built to be PowerShell driven with UI over top to generate the PowerShell commands.Support this podcast at — https://redcircle.com/net-rocks/donations

22 Maalis 201143min

Jon Snook Takes CSS3 Seriously

Jon Snook Takes CSS3 Seriously

Carl and Richard talk to Jonathan Snook about Cascading Style Sheets (CSS). Jon is a designer and developer, which makes him a rare creature indeed. He talks about the history and role of CSS in web development and how CSS3 makes significant strides in equalizing design and layout between browsers.Support this podcast at — https://redcircle.com/net-rocks/donations

17 Maalis 201146min

Scott Millett Gets Our Specs Sharp!

Scott Millett Gets Our Specs Sharp!

Carl and Richard talk to Scott Millett about SpecFlow, a free tool to help you implement Behaviour Driven Design. SpecFlow lets you build plain text requirements that actually connect with code and tests to help reinforce acceptance testing. The conversation also wanders over design patterns in general and ASP.NET specifically. Scott also talks through the various free tools he uses together to build better software.Support this podcast at — https://redcircle.com/net-rocks/donations

15 Maalis 201143min

Kent Alstad Makes Javascript Perform

Kent Alstad Makes Javascript Perform

Carl and Richard talk to Kent Alstad about the state of Javascript today. Kent admits that he has fallen in love with Javascript of late, that the newest browsers make Javascript incredibly fast and powerful. The conversation digs into how to keep Javascript fast, which is primarily focused on downloading the right bytes at the right time - when in doubt, delay! Kent is down in the nitty gritty of web site performance, his insight on what to do to make things go faster will blow your mind.Support this podcast at — https://redcircle.com/net-rocks/donations

10 Maalis 201157min

Mark Miller and Seth Juarez Go Mad with Kinect!

Mark Miller and Seth Juarez Go Mad with Kinect!

Carl and Richard talk to Mark Miller and Seth Juarez about their crazy experiments with Kinect. The boys discuss how they are building an interface with Kinect to do programming with Visual Studio 2010. A large part of this conversation ends up diving deep into the relative merits of machine learning in systems. Are we crossing the streams? You bet!Support this podcast at — https://redcircle.com/net-rocks/donations

8 Maalis 201151min

Bruce Lawson and Remy Sharp on HTML 5

Bruce Lawson and Remy Sharp on HTML 5

Carl and Richard talk to Bruce Lawson and Remi Sharp about HTML 5. Bruce and Remy have been involved with HTML 5 from the early days, although more as activists than movers-and-shakers. They provide some great insight into how HTML 5 has come to be and how regular developers can get involved and affect the outcome of an important specification. Bruce and Remy have one of the very first books out on HTML 5, creatively named Introduction to HTML 5.Support this podcast at — https://redcircle.com/net-rocks/donations

3 Maalis 201159min